NVIDIA

Quadro 4000

The Quadro 4000 is manufactured by NVIDIA. It was released in November 2 2010. It features the Fermi architecture. The core clock speed is 475 MHz. It has 256 shading units. The thermal design power (TDP) is 142W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 1,475 points. Launch price was $1,199.

AMD

Radeon Vega 6 Ryzen 3 3350U

The Radeon Vega 6 Ryzen 3 3350U is manufactured by AMD. It was released in January 7 2020. It features the Vega architecture. The core clock ranges from 400 MHz to 1500 MHz. It has 384 shading units. The thermal design power (TDP) is 15W. Manufactured using 7 nm process technology. G3D Mark benchmark score: 1,420 points.
